I love showing kids that the wild stuff they see in movies or around them is actually science in action, not magic. That 'wow' moment when a pencil floats or a homemade crane works - that's what I live for. It’s all about helping your child spot science in everyday life.
Science here is hands-on. We don’t just talk, we build things together - circuits, cranes, security systems, you name it. I want every kid who joins to ask questions, mess up sometimes, and figure things out themselves. Curiosity is at the center of everything we do, and mistakes are part of the fun.
Kids become scientists for the day, not just sitting and listening. We do one-on-one, so each child gets attention. We build, test, sometimes fail, and always learn. If it’s a longer camp, kids take their creations home, so the fun keeps going.

Anyone from 4 to 14 years old. I break my programs by age, so tiny tots (4-7) get their own 'Science Junior' fun, older kids get more complex stuff.
One-day workshops, weekend classes, after-school sessions, school holiday science camps during summer and Dasara - lots of ways to fit science into your child’s routine.

What we offer - Immersive science camp, weekend classes, hands-on science workshops, science-themed birthday parties, and help with school projects.
How we do it - No boring lectures. You build stuff—catapults, metal detectors, solar rovers, even a hydraulic crane. It’s all DIY science projects for kids.
Our Approach - One-on-one, always personal. We link experiments to school topics, but in our own fun way. Real world, not just theory.
For all age groups - Science Juniors (4-7), Science Squad (7-12), Tinkering Club (8-13). You build, you take home what you make.
